- Abusive conduct: means verbal, nonverbal, or physical conduct of an employee to another employee of the same employer that, based on the severity, nature, or frequency of the conduct, a reasonable person would determine:
(i) is intended to cause intimidation, humiliation, or unwarranted distress; (ii) results in substantial physical harm or substantial psychological harm as a result of intimidation, humiliation, or unwarranted distress; or (iii) exploits an employee's known physical or psychological disability. See Utah Code 67-26-102 - Abusive conduct complaint process: means the process described in Section 67-26-202. See Utah Code 67-26-102
- Administrative review process: means a process that allows an employee, in relation to the findings of an abusive conduct investigation, to seek an administrative review that:
(a) an employer conducts in accordance with Section 67-26-202; or (b) in relation to a state executive branch agency, the Career Service Review Office conducts in accordance with Section 67-19a-501.
